Recently, the technology of robot vision was improving with the development of science and technology in various fields, emerging some successful vision systems. However, traditional methods based on the algorithms could not meet the demands. As a critical subject, research of robot vision based on the biological mechanism contains a comprehensive theoretical, such as visual physiology, cognitive neuroscience, computational neuroscience science, physiological psychology, robotics, and modern mathematics. Researches on this subject stimulate the visual perception theory and robot technology as well as the mechanism of biological vision and in-depth study of the development of cognitive science.This dissertation focuses on the cognition of location in the robot vision based on electrophysiology, anatomy and brain science research for the theory, following the primate's visual system as a model.Chapter 2 introduces the definition and classification of the primate visual cortex, giving the brain region of two-dimensional reconstruction map of primate visual cortex. Borders of regions of the visual cortex have been defined and The theory of two pathways of the visual cortex in primates was introduced. Chapter 3 describes the regional organizations of primate retina and visual cortex in detail. The regional organizations of visual cortex was defined, according to electrophysiology projection from the relationship and connection, a single-cell recording and anatomical connections, the relationship between cell structure and connectivity. The projection relationship between retina, primary visual cortex and advanced visual cortex was found. The expression method and the paths of different parts of our vision in cortex were described. Chapter 4 designs two-dimensional coordinate's software of visual cortex using the projection disciplines between retina and visual cortex. Also, this chapter designs the various scopes of regions of the visual cortex in the software for the expression on the vision, showing the relationship between vision, retinopathy of software, and the visual cortex in detail. A discussion of the location of a point was held.Chapter 5 describes and proves the mathematical laws hidden in the location cognition using knowledge of category and topology. Through the description, the disciplines of information transmission and the structural features of biological and robotic visual systems were revealed. Chapter 6 of this article in C + + builder software environment for the conduct of a number of simple experiments, through the programming experiment, the vision of a better description of the various parts of the region in the software presented in the visual cortex results. Chapter 7 of this article are summarize of the research and the prospect.In this paper, the main conclusions were as follows:(1)To explore the work mechanism of primate visual system,And use it to design the robot vision system is entirely feasible, the location of a "point" the initial cognitive can be achieved.(2)The mechanism of primate visual system and the mechanism of robot visual system satisfy the equivalence relation of topological.(3) In the process of Location information cognitive, a different constitute combination of elements in space of the visual cortex region, representative of the different concept cognitive.
